			This moves all fixup snippets to the .text.fixup section, which is a special section that gets emitted along with the .text section for each input object file, i.e., the snippets are kept much closer to the code they refer to, which helps prevent linker failure on large kernels. | /*
 | |
|  * FIXME: minor buglet here
 | |
|  * We don't return the checksum for the data present in the buffer.  To do
 | |
|  * so properly, we would have to add in whatever registers were loaded before
 | |
|  * the fault, which, with the current asm above is not predictable.
 | |
|  */
